We put on quite a few shows every year, catering for all levels of musical ability and always offering a lot of fun.

A semi-staged Concert Performance (or two) each year requires no auditions for the chorus. This is a chance for everyone to take part in a show; particularly if you can't dance! One of the concert performances is usually held early in May Week, with the few chorus rehearsals held earlier in the term when there is less exam pressure. Keen singers can audition for the solo roles, and once again there is less emphasis on acting ability than for the main shows.

The Main Cambridge Show in the middle of the Lent Term has now returned to its old home in Arts Theatre, having been held in the Cambridge Corn Exchange for three years while the Arts Theatre was being refurbished (1993-96). The G&S society shows are some of the largest student productions in Cambridge—they are always exciting and innovative. The commitment is high, but almost everyone who has been in a G&S show has loved the experience and most come back and perform again year after year.

The Minack Theatre

During the summer, the infamous Cornwall Show takes place, usually in the open air Minack Theatre (see the forthcoming shows section for details of this year's summer show). The show is rehearsed for two weeks, followed by a one week run. The weather is usually great, the beaches are nearby and the performance is always stunning. It is difficult to stop people from coming back.

We also perform some light opera and musical theatre not written by Gilbert and Sullivan, including Orpheus in the Underworld in 2005.
